Children celebrate Literacy Week

By DULCIE OREKE
IT was a day of celebrations for children at the Buk Bilong Pikinini Library in Port Moresby yesterday.
To mark Literacy Week, which ends today, more than 60 smiling faces beamed their pleasure when author Dianna Donigi read one of her books to them at the University of Papua New Guinea location.    
Donigi presented two “big books and seven small reading books” to the library.
Buk Bilong Pikinini director Ali Nott praised Donigi’s gesture.
She said the books would be helpful for children, particularly as they were suitable for the PNG culture.
She said the books could be used during special occasions.  
Nott said the library was privileged at obtaining such books. 
Head librarian Wari Korona said the UPNG Buk Bilong Pikinini Library served children from Baruni, National Research Institute, Rainbow, Gerehu and parts of Morata.
